Livx Capital vs Lux Trading Firm: Detailed Analysis

Livx Capital and Lux Trading Firm are both CFD firms. Lux Trading Firm has been in business longer, established in 2020, while Livx Capital was founded in 2024.

In terms of pricing, Livx Capital is more affordable with challenges starting at $37, which is $162 less than Lux Trading Firm's starting price of $199. Livx Capital offers 3 challenge options, while Lux Trading Firm offers 3.

Livx Capital offers 70% profit split, while Lux Trading Firm offers 80% to the trader. Livx Capital pays out Weekly, and Lux Trading Firm pays out Monthly.

For trust and reputation, Livx Capital has a 3.7/5 TrustPilot rating with 97 reviews, while Lux Trading Firm has 3.7/5 with 625 reviews. Safety grades: Livx Capital C, Lux Trading Firm B+.

Overall, Lux Trading Firm edges ahead winning 4 out of 5 categories we compared. However, the best choice depends on your specific needs — both firms have their strengths.

Pros & Cons

Livx Capital
Pros
Weekly payouts with 70% profit split, no time limit on evaluations, multiple platforms, Forex/Commodities/Indices/Crypto access, 24/7 multilingual support, active Discord community, low entry price ($37 for 5K Zero)
Cons
Modest 70% profit split (industry standard is 80-90%), 7-day cooldown between payouts, smaller TrustPilot review base (97 reviews), no regulatory license, mixed reviews regarding payout disputes
Lux Trading Firm
Pros
Scaling up to $1M allocation. Instant anytime payouts. 6% static drawdown (not trailing). London-based, established 2020.
Cons
Mandatory stop-loss on all trades. 5% max risk per trade. No HFT or arbitrage. 1:30 leverage only. Pricing in GBP.
